Leeds United’s players and staff should be delighted with what was a comprehensive 3-0 win over Millwall at The New Den on Sunday.
Daniel Farke’s stars have shown before now that they’re capable of producing superb away performances, as Ipswich found out earlier in the campaign.
The south Londoners were on the back foot as soon as Joel Piroe opened the scoring in the 15th minute, and whilst it took until the 77th minute for him to add a second, followed by Georginio Rutter’s strike four minutes later, the result was rarely in doubt.
